Overview of Filipino population in San Francisco County
- Population Count and Percentage: American Community Survey data shows San Francisco County contains 44,252 Filipino residents (5.3% of 836,321 total county population), ranking the jurisdiction at the 99th percentile nationally among counties and 76th percentile within California for Filipino demographic concentrations across both absolute and proportional measures.
- Comparison to State and National Averages: Census Bureau's ACS show San Francisco County's Filipino population of 5.3% surpassing both California's state average of 4.3% and the national average of 1.3%, positioning the county as a high-concentration jurisdiction exceeding demographic benchmarks across all geographic scales.
- Share of Total State Population: Official American Community Survey data documents San Francisco County with 44,252 Filipino residents, representing 2.6% of California's total Filipino population of 1.7 million.

How the Census defines Filipino population
The U.S. Census Bureau allows people to self-identify their ancestry, meaning individuals can write upto ancestries when responding to the survey. In this ranking, we include everyone who identifies as having Filipino ancestry, whether alone or in combination with another ancestry.
Here are a few important things to know about how ancestry is reported:
- Some people identify as Filipino alone, while others identify as Filipino along with another race (such as Filipino and German).
- We’ve used the “Filipino alone or in any combination” category unless noted otherwise, which gives a broader picture of the Filipino population in each area.

Things to Keep in Mind
Like all survey-based data, ACS estimates come with some limitations. Here are a few things to be aware of:
- In places with very small Filipino populations, the numbers may not be reported at all due to privacy protections or sampling variability in the survey.
- Since the ACS is based on a sample, the numbers are estimates, not exact counts. That means they may slightly differ from other sources like the decennial U.S. Census.
